Terrace Sealing in Kitsap County, WA
Terrace sealing services involve applying a protective coating to outdoor terrace surfaces, such as concrete, stone, or pavers, to prevent water infiltration, reduce damage from the elements, and enhance the overall appearance. This process is suitable for various projects, including residential patios, walkways, and entertainment areas, helping property owners maintain the durability and longevity of their outdoor spaces. Homeowners typically seek terrace sealing to safeguard their investment, improve curb appeal, and ensure their outdoor surfaces remain functional and attractive over time.

Common Terrace Sealing Jobs
Terrace sealing - Protects outdoor living spaces from water damage and weathering.
Patio sealing - Enhances the durability and appearance of concrete or stone patios.
Deck sealing - Shields wood or composite decks from moisture and UV rays.
Porch sealing - Preserves porch surfaces against cracking, staining, and wear.
Balcony sealing - Prevents water infiltration and extends the lifespan of balcony structures.
Walkway sealing - Maintains safety and aesthetics by sealing cracks and surface imperfections.
Terrace Sealing Questions
What is terrace sealing? Terrace sealing involves applying a protective coating to outdoor terrace surfaces to prevent water penetration and damage.
Which terrace surfaces can be sealed? Most common terrace surfaces, including concrete, stone, and pavers, can be sealed to enhance durability.
How often should a terrace be resealed? Resealing is typically recommended every few years to maintain protection and appearance.
What are the benefits of sealing a terrace? Sealing helps prevent water damage, reduces staining, and extends the lifespan of the surface.
